Tank:

Fluval Flora Tank 8G
Filtration:

aquaclear 70 with chaeto, seachem purigen, heater and Wavepoint 8 watt LED.

9 pounds LR

10 pounds LS.
Lighting:

RapidLED 12 LED's Par38 (6 Rb, 2NW, 2CW and 2 UV LEDS. 80 degree optics) 8" off the water.

Here is another hitchiker. My question is can I put him in the tank since I already have 1 pistol shrimp in there and this one is about half the size of the pistol in the tank now.

CRW_8569.jpg

Link to comment
Here is another hitchiker. My question is can I put him in the tank since I already have 1 pistol shrimp in there and this one is about half the size of the pistol in the tank now.

 

Nope. You can't have two pistol shrimp in a tank that small. They will try to kill each other. You'd need a very large tank to have more than one.

Link to comment
Nope. You can't have two pistol shrimp in a tank that small. They will try to kill each other. You'd need a very large tank to have more than one.

 

Okay cool. I will see if my LFS will take him for some store credit.

Nice carnation coral, what do you plan on feeding it?

 

So far I have been turning the pumps off, fill a turkey baster with water and add about 3 drops of phyto feast to the baster then squirting it at the carnation until most of the polyps have closed up.

 

I know they are a harder coral to care for and I will do my best to keep them alive, but all 4 frags was only $20 so if I lose them its not the end of the world

 

Glad to see another fellow college reefer's tank! :)

NorCal college reefers are few and far between, from my experience at least.

Link to comment
So far I have been turning the pumps off, fill a turkey baster with water and add about 3 drops of phyto feast to the baster then squirting it at the carnation until most of the polyps have closed up.

 

I know they are a harder coral to care for and I will do my best to keep them alive, but all 4 frags was only $20 so if I lose them its not the end of the world

I hope it works out for you. They require near constant foods, and should only be in a mature system. They should be fed micro planton foods, also BBS and smar particulare foods meant for filter feeders. Most people that have NPS have dosers to feed constantly.

Link to comment
I hope it works out for you. They require near constant foods, and should only be in a mature system. They should be fed micro planton foods, also BBS and smar particulare foods meant for filter feeders. Most people that have NPS have dosers to feed constantly.

 

I know I jumped into a coral that will be difficult to care for and I will try my best. Thanks for the info.
